This is a shaker card that I made using the Diemond Dies large mason jar as the base, a piece of plastic packaging material that I upcycled to make the cover, and some cute little dragonfly shakers (I added some blue and iridescent sequins for a little extra sparkle inside the shaker too) that I made with Shrinky Dinks and the new Diemond Dies dragonfly die. I inked around the edges of the mason jar with a blue green American Crafts ink and also inked the lower level of the scene to create a lake look on which the little beaver could be floating. \u00a0I colored him, the branch he is holding and the log he is standing on using the following Copic colors: E21, 23, 25, 29 and 100. I added a little BG18 just for the leaves. \u00a0Since the background paper color was a light tan, I also used a white Gelly Roll pen to brighten his front teeth. \ud83d\ude42<\/p>\n The following is a tutorial video for this shaker:<\/p>\n
